  2023 SOUTHLAND CONFERENCE DEFENSIVE PLAYER OF THE YEAR: Jalyx Hunt, HCU,...Jalyx Hunt was a standout on the field all season as he earned SLC Defensive Player of the Year, earning invitations to both the Reese's Senior Bowl and the East/West Shrine Bowl, accepting the invitation to the Senior Bowl set for Feb. 3 in Mobile, Ala. Hunt was also a finalist for the Buck Buchanan Award to the nation's top defensive player. He filled up the stat sheet this season with 46 tackles, nine tackles for loss, 6.5 sacks, two forced fumbles, two fumble recoveries, one interception with a return for a touchdown, three quarterback hurries, two pass breakups and a blocked kick in 10 games. In conference play, Hunt averaged more than a sack per game with all 6.5 of his sacks coming against league opponents. Hunt becomes the second HCU athlete to ever win Defensive Player of the Year, joining Caleb Johnson, current linebacker for the Jacksonville Jaguars, in 2020. - Southland Conference Football

  SEPT 4 SOUTHLAND CONFERENCE DEFENSIVE PLAYER OF THE WEEK: Jalyx Hunt, HBU - LB - Junior - Debary, Fla. (University HS),...Hunt filled the stat sheet with seven tackles, two for loss, a sack, a quarterback hurry, a pass breakup, a forced fumble and a fumble recovery for a touchdown. With the Huskies clinging to a 39-34 lead with under a minute left and Northern Colorado driving in HBU territory, freshman defensive end Jacoby Brass forced a fumble on a sack, then Hunt scooped it up and returned it 45 yards for the game-sealing touchdown.   Jalyx Hunt returned a fumble for a 46-yard touchdown to help Houston Baptist hold off a furious Northern Colorado comeback attempt for a 46-34 win in a season opener for both teams Saturday. The Bears scored 20 points in the fourth quarter to close within 39-34. Following Northern Colorado's recovery of an onside kick, the Huskies' Jacoby Brass forced a fumble by quarterback Jacob Sirmon to set up Hunt's scoop and score with 1:06 left. Houston Baptist, which went 0-11 in 2021, won its first game since a 33-30 victory over Eastern Kentucky on Oct. 3, 2020 in a four-game fall campaign due to COVID-19. The Huskies entered having lost 20 of 22 contests since Oct. 5, 2019. Northern Colorado entered having won its three previous games in the all-time series against the Huskies. - AP College Football
